Will sharpie stay on plastic water bottle?

Sharpie Oil Based Markers can be used on plastic. The traditional alcohol based Sharpie Markers are not ideal for plastic. They will smear and ultimately fade over time.

What kind of ink can you use to print on silicone?

Nothing sticks to silicone but silicone. This means that only silicone ink can be used to print on silicone rubber wristbands or any silicone part. Boston Industrial Solutions, Inc. has developed the Natron™ SE silicone ink to adhere to any silicone rubber product with or without heat.

Which is the starting material for silicone compound?

The starting material is metallic silicon, which is obtained from silica sand. Silicon is reacted with methyl chloride (CH3Cl) over a copper catalyst, forming dimethyldichlorosilane ([CH3]2Si[Cl]2). By reacting this compound with water, the chlorine atoms are replaced by hydroxyl (OH) groups.
